Index to birth record, Thamesville, Kent Co., ON: Daugherty Charles Henry, born 18 Feb 1876.

from Thamesville Herald, extracted by Jay Smith for Kent Branch of the OGS:
3 Dec 1942: Died 30 Nov Charles Henry Daugherty b: 17 Feb 1875 s/o Amos & Ann (Tape), f/o Orval, b/o Mrs William Bowles, Mrs Frank Hank, John, Anse & Joe, buried Mayhew's.

Chatham Daily News Saturday 5 December 1942
C. H. Daugherty Borne to Rest
Thamesville, Dec. 5 - Funeral services for Charles Henry Daugherty who passed away early in the week following a severe heart attack, were held on Thursday afternoon from the J. R. Smith Funeral Home, conducted by Rev. John Cristea of the Baptist Church.
Interment was made in Mayhew cemetery.
Acting as pall bearers were Messrs. Henry MacFarlane, William Bonney, William Merriem, John Anderson, Clare Skinner and Gordon Carther.
Mr. Daugherty was in his 67th year and was born in Thamesville a son of the late Amos Daugherty and Susan A. Tape. For many years he was employed by the Canadian National Railways on the section and later as a watchman at the crossing gates. For several years he served at Windsor in the latter capacity only returning to Thamesville during the past year.
Surviving are his widow and one son Urville of Thamesville, two sisters, Mrs. William Bowles, Thamesville and Mrs. F. Hanks, Florence, and three brothers John Daugherty of Thamesville, and Anson and Joseph of Lambton County.
